Pinch Weld and new 33x10.5 tsl's

Hello,

I ordered a set of 33x10.5 tsl radials yesterday and have a few question? I have a few sets of rims available to put them on, factory steel for 31", AR aluminums, and ar steelies, I looked a as many threads as possilbe but could not find pics of the pinch weld mod? Also a backspacing link that was posted states that the greater the backspacing the less your tire stick out, this seems to be contrary to what people are saying,(https://www.rsracing.com/tech-wheel.html#backspace). What wheels do you guys recomend for the tsl's and where is the pinch weld?

Thanks

The pinch weld mod is simply pounding the pinch weld flat. No pics needed. You use a BFH.

The pinch weld is behind the plastic insert at the rear of your front fender. Remove the insert, pound it flat, and replace the insert.

Use the factory rims, they will work fine. Backspacing on that page is properly defined/described. Just realize that the picture of the backspacing is with the rims upside down.
